About

Uday Kumar is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Information Systems and Ocean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Uday Kumar has authored 61 papers receiving a total of 1.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, 7 papers in Information Systems and 7 papers in Ocean Engineering. Recurrent topics in Uday Kumar's work include Cardiac pacing and defibrillation studies (8 papers),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(8 papers) and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(7 papers). Uday Kumar is often cited by papers focused on Cardiac pacing and defibrillation studies (8 papers),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(8 papers) and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(7 papers). Uday Kumar collaborates with scholars based in United States, India and Italy. Uday Kumar's co-authors include Jill Schafer, Elyse Foster, Leslie A. Saxon, Teresa De Marco, Kanu Chatterjee, Rajni K. Rao, Esperanza Viloria, Todd J. Brinton, Paul G. Yock and Paul A. Heidenreich and has published in prestigious journals such as Circulation, Blood and Journal of the American College of Cardiology.
